I've purchased a few parts on S@H that were cheaper than Bricklink. White lampost, new baseball cap, animal hero forge masks, those rubbery spike things used on Ninjago and hero forge, blank light bley torsos. Also it can be a lot cheaper on shipping if you need many parts in bulk versus bricklink where one store probably doesn't have all you need. Additionally, earning VIP points. -
I don't have an exact count but I'd guess over 3000. I know I do have more than 2800 torsos cataloged, that is what I keep track of most diligently. Based on recent purchases and the box of "yet to be cataloged" torsos, that would easily bring me over 3k. As for storage, I don't keep many figs built. I have a few favorites/customs/current project figures in a case and a separate display case for each of the Collectible Minifigures, by set. Everything else is stored by part (torso, legs, heads, etc). Most parts are in small tool organzers by color, torsos are all in one bin but sorted in baggies by color and theme, heads are sorted by print (bear, clean shaven, glasses, female, pirate, monster,...etc). Oh and in general I don't build armies. ten of one design is usually my limit unless I'm working on something very specific that requires more of the same torso.
